NEW SOUTH WALES
PEB PRESS ASSOCIATION
Sydney, December 15. Dr Barry, Bishop of Sydney, resigned owing to the ill health of Mrs Barry. In the baseball match to-day between the American and the Chicago teams the former won, after an interesting game, by 1 run. . The barque Thurso, which arrived from Lyttelton yesterday, had a tempestuous passage. The deadlight of the forecastle was stove m, and the fore compartment filled with water," and it fa believed that the cargo is coniiderdbly damaged. The decision of the Assembly m respect to leasing the city tramways is creating much excitement The Preis expresses the opinion that the proposal will be negatived, owing to the grow scandals afloat- m reference to the 'matter, and the corruption alleged to; have been attempted to influence the Votes of members. It is urged that. the Government should immediately hold an inquiry into the matter. It is thought not improbable that the Government will resign or eveociuifl a dissolution of Parliament. - : -
